P0052 – HO2S Heater Control Circuit High (Bank 2 Sensor 1)

The P0052 Diagnostic Trouble Code (DTC) indicates that the Engine Control Module (ECM) has detected a high voltage or high input condition in the heater control circuit of the Heated Oxygen Sensor (HO2S) located at Bank 2 Sensor 1. This may be caused by a short to battery voltage, wiring faults, or a defective oxygen sensor heater.

Severity: ★★★☆☆ (Moderate)
The vehicle is usually safe to drive, but prolonged operation may increase fuel consumption and exhaust emissions.

What Does Code P0052 Mean?

P0052 is a generic OBD-II powertrain code indicating that the ECM has detected an abnormally high voltage in the heater circuit of the upstream oxygen sensor on Bank 2. The heater is designed to warm the sensor quickly after engine start so the fuel control system can enter closed-loop operation sooner.

Bank 2 Sensor 1 Location

  • Bank 2 = The engine bank opposite cylinder No.1.
  • Sensor 1 = Upstream oxygen sensor located before the catalytic converter.

Possible Causes

Short to battery voltage in the heater circuit

Faulty oxygen sensor heater element

Damaged or melted wiring harness

Poor connector condition

Incorrect replacement oxygen sensor

Faulty ECM driver (rare)

How to Diagnose P0052

  1. Read all stored DTCs using a scan tool.
  2. Inspect the oxygen sensor connector.
  3. Check for a short to battery voltage.
  4. Inspect wiring for melted insulation or damage.
  5. Measure heater resistance with a digital multimeter.
  6. Verify proper voltage and ground at the heater circuit.
  7. Test ECM control if the circuit passes all inspections.

Typical Heater Specifications

Supply Voltage

Typically 12–14 volts.

Heater Resistance

Usually between 3–20 Ω depending on sensor design.

Normal Operation

The heater should operate only when commanded by the ECM.

Important: Always compare voltage and resistance values with the factory service information because specifications differ between vehicle manufacturers.

Common Repairs

Replace the faulty oxygen sensor.

Repair shorted wiring.

Repair or replace damaged connectors.

Replace the heater fuse if necessary.

Install the correct OEM-spec sensor.

Replace or reprogram the ECM only if all other tests pass.

Frequently Asked Questions

Can I drive with P0052?

Yes. Most vehicles remain drivable, but the fault should be repaired promptly to maintain proper fuel control and emission performance.

What usually causes P0052?

The most common causes are a short to battery voltage, damaged wiring, or a faulty oxygen sensor heater element.

Diagnostic Tip: Before replacing the oxygen sensor, verify heater voltage, inspect the wiring for a short to power, and measure heater resistance. Many P0052 faults are caused by electrical wiring issues rather than the sensor itself.
